Real Madrid want €15 million for out-of-favour star; La Liga club offer only €5 million

Dani Ceballos is once again one of the names circulating in the transfer market. As has been the case in recent summers, his future at Real Madrid remains uncertain, and Real Betis are once again monitoring the situation closely.

A return to his former club appears complicated, mainly due to Real Madrid’s demands and the player’s salary.

Real Madrid want €15 million

Indeed, according to AS, Real Betis are only offering €5 million to Real Madrid for Ceballos, who are asking for €15 million to let him go.

The Spanish midfielder is not in the plans of manager Xabi Alonso, who barely used him during the FIFA Club World Cup after taking over from Carlo Ancelotti.

The likes of Federico Valverde, Aurelien Tchouameni, Eduardo Camavinga, Jude Bellingham, and Arda Guler, now seen as a midfielder, are all ahead of Ceballos in the pecking order.

So, despite the departure of Luka Modric, he is unlikely to see regular game-time and as such, an exit is very much a possibility.

Real Betis have emerged as a potential destination, but there is a major disparity in the amount they are offering (€5 million) and what Real Madrid are expecting (€15 million).

Ceballos’ cryptic post

While currently on holiday, Ceballos posted the following message on Instagram: “Nothing gives more peace of mind than saying ‘I tried everything.’”

According to the report, this message possibly refers to his efforts to secure a move to Betis. The midfielder, for his part, would be willing to lower his wages to return, but the difference in the fee being demanded and offered remains a hurdle.

Ceballos ended up deleting his post a few hours later after seeing the reaction it caused on social media.

Just a few days ago, the Real Madrid player publicly expressed his desire to play for Betis again one day.

“Betis is my home and it always will be. I hope the door stays open forever. We will talk about the future after this week. There have not been any meetings yet,”he said.
